英文摘要
DESCRIPTION (provided by applicant): Vestibular, proprioceptive and visual
inputs are integrated by the central nervous system to produce appropriate
ocular motor and postural responses. Cervical afferents provide unique
information that enable head-referenced signals from the visual and vestibular
systems to be transformed into trunk-referenced signals. Many patients with
balance disorders note an association between a worsening of their dizziness and
neck discomfort. The basis for this association is unknown. The long-term
objective of this research is to develop a rational approach to the diagnosis of
cervicogenic dizziness and to the assessment of cervical influences on
vestibular disorders. Each of the three specific aims of this exploratory
research proposal relates to improving our understanding of cervical influences
on balance. In particular, the goal of the experiments proposed herein is to
generate testable hypotheses regarding objective measures of cervical influences
on vestibulo-ocular and vestibular-spinal responses, and on visually induced
postural sway. The specific aims of this proposal are to explore three different
aspects of the cervical influences on balance: 1. The influence of roll head-on-trunk
position on the orientation of Listing's plane with respect to the head,
2. The influence of yaw head-on-trunk position on postural sway induced by
sinusoidal interaural galvanic vestibular stimulation, and 3. The influence of
yaw head-on-trunk position on postural sway induced by naso-occipital optic
flow. To address specific aim #1, three-dimensional eye positions will be
monitored during various combinations of head and trunk roll tilt using dual-scleral
search coils. To address specific aim #2, postural sway induced by
sinusoidal, bipolar, binaural galvanic vestibular stimulation during several yaw
head-on-trunk positions will be measured. To address specific aim #3, postural
sway will be measured in response to naso-occipital optic flow within a virtual
reality environment during several yaw head-on-trunk positions.
